NFL Draft: Drake Maye Could be Washington Commanders’ Top Pick Following Impressive Visit
The NFL Draft is approaching, with top quarterbacks expected to be among the first picks. Former UNC player Drake Maye is a contender for the second-fifth overall selection and recently favored his visit with the Washington Commanders.
By the Numbers- Maye nearly combined for 10,000 scrimmage yards and 80 touchdowns during his college career.
- Washington Commanders chose Sam Howell, another former Tar Heel, in the fifth round of the 2022 draft.
- Maye's recent visit with the Washington Commanders has been his favorite so far.
- If chosen by the Commanders, Maye would be the second former Tar Heel to join the team in DC.
Drake Maye, a top quarterback prospect, favors the possibility of playing for the Washington Commanders, potentially becoming the second former Tar Heel to join the team in DC.
